Optimization of the operating parameters for the extractive synthesis of biolubricant from sesame seed oil via response surface methodology

open access: yesEgyptian Journal of Petroleum, 2018
This study examined the optimization of the transesterification reaction of sesame methyl esters (SMEs) with trimethylolpropane (TMP) to synthesise sesame biolubricant (SBL).

Ultrasonic Intensification To Produce Diester Biolubricants

open access: yesIndustrial & Engineering Chemistry Research, 2019
Biolubricants synthesized from vegetable oils with oleic acid and 1,3-propanediol possess better cold flow properties and have a smaller environmental footprint than mineral-based lubricants. However, their synthesis is lengthy (>6 h) and requires temperatures above 120 °C.
